NFL Fires Official Who Decided It Was A Good Idea To Sell Some Of The ‘Deflategate' Footballs

The NFL has fired a league official who sold a number of the “deflategate” footballs used during the AFC Championship Game, according to ESPN.

The official was one of a few NFL employees who helped handle the balls on the day of the game. He was supposed to give the footballs to a charity afterward, but “allegedly [sold] off some of those footballs on the side" instead, according to a transcript of ESPN reporter Adam Schefter’s report on the firing provided by PFT.
